Philatelic Week Issued on April 20, 1973 (Showa 48) In April 1973, the Ministry of Posts and Telecommunications issued stamp hobby week stamps. This time, Ryusei Kishida's painting "Sumiyoshi Mode (Woman who visits Sumiyoshi Shrine)" was adopted. Ryusei Kishida has created numerous masterpieces with her unique aesthetic sense based on realism, such as portraits, landscape paintings, and still life paintings, and has been highly acclaimed as a genius painter representing the history of modern Japanese art.
